Big5 . . . have you hunted in the Game reserve for the Gredos Ibex? I may say that the rocks in the Gredos area are a bit more tricky than the Beceite area. For Gredos the paths make you cross areas with many stones that can move when you step on them and get really slippery with the morning dew or fog or bit of rain so you must be extra careful. :Happy:

Yes, I did hunt the Gredos Mountains and took a terrific ram. With morning fog and dew the rocks and boulders were a bit slippery but nothing I found to be unmanageable. Although I took my ram just below the summit our upward trek was not what I would consider overly difficult.
